Ligaments are strong, elastic bands of tissue that connect bone to bone. They provide strength and stability to the joint. They may be stretched, or sometimes torn. Both sprains and strains are common injuries, but they’re not the same. A sprain happens when you stretch or tear a ligament, which is the tissue that connects bones at a joint.
